Spice Fire One Mi-FX2 Firefox OS Smartphone Launched in India for Rs. 2799

Spice Fire One Mi-FX2, the second Firefox OS smartphone from Spice, is now available from Saholic for Rs 2799. Earlier, the company has launched Spice Fire One Mi-FX 1 for just Rs 2,299.

Spice Fire One Mi-FX2

The new Spice Fire One Mi-FX2 features a small 3.5-inch HVGA (320 x 480 pixels) screen powered by a 1GHz processor, similar to the Mi-FX1, which was launched last year. But, this smartphone supports 3G connectivity, and earlier was only a 2G phone.

The Spice Fire One Mi-FX2 houses a 2-megapixel rear camera with dual-LED flash and a 1.3-megapixel front-facing camera for selfies and video calling. It is equipped with 256MB of RAM and 512MB internal storage is expandable via microSD up to 32GB.

The Fire One Mi-FX2 runs Firefox OS 1.4 and has a Dual SIM slot with dual standby functionality. Other connectivity options include a 3.5mm audio jack, FM Radio, 3G,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, Bluetooth 3.0, and aGPS. It also packs a 1100mAh battery.

The Spice Fire One Mi-FX2 comes in Tangy Orange, Midnight Black, and Ash Silver colors.
